Question 55482: Help, I'm very lost - if I could get help solving this one the rest should come back to me, I hope.
6.2(x - 15.1) = 9.3(-x - 3.2)

6.2(x - 15.1) = 9.3(-x - 3.2)
:
Mult what's inside the brackets first:
6.2x - 93.62 = -9.3x - 29.76
:
If decimals bother you, mult eq by 100 to get rid of them,
620x - 9362 = -930x - 2976
:
Perform the necessary operations to get the variable on the left and the numerical values on the right:
:
Add 9362 to both sides:
620x = -930x - 2976 + 9362
:
Add 930x to both sides, add the numerical values
620x + 930x = + 6386
:
Add the x's
1550x = 6386
:
Divide both sides by 1550
x = 6386/1550
:
x = 4.12
:
:
Check our solution by substituting 4.12 for x in the original equation:
6.2(x - 15.1) = 9.3(-x - 3.2)
:
6.2(4.12 - 15.1`) = 9.3(-4.12 -3.2)
:
Do the math inside the brackets and you have:
6.2(-10.98) = 9.3(-7.32)
:
-68.076 = -68.076 confirms our solution of x = 4.12.
:
A good idea to always check your solution in the original equation.
